Sodexo is seeking an Armed Forces Site Administrator at RAF Odiham, providing essential administrative support. The role involves managing information, assisting management with tasks, and improving the quality of life for Armed Forces personnel.
Ideal candidates should be team-oriented, able to prioritize effectively, and have strong computer skills.
The role offers extensive training, career development opportunities, and a supportive work environment, with financial benefits and work perks like a Cycle to Work Scheme.
